private static Exception throwCause(Exception e, boolean combineStackTraces) throws Exception { Throwable cause = e.getCause(); if (cause == null) { throw e; } if (combineStackTraces) { StackTraceElement[] combined = ObjectArrays.concat(cause.getStackTrace(), e.getStackTrace(), StackTraceElement.class); cause.setStackTrace(combined); } if (cause instanceof Exception) { throw (Exception) cause; } if (cause instanceof Error) { throw (Error) cause; } // The cause is a weird kind of Throwable, so throw the outer exception. throw e; }
/** * Find a {@link Method} to handle the given exception. * Use {@link ExceptionDepthComparator} if more than one match is found. * @param exception the exception * @return a Method to handle the exception, or {@code null} if none found */ @Nullable public Method resolveMethod(Exception exception) { Method method = resolveMethodByExceptionType(exception.getClass()); if (method == null) { Throwable cause = exception.getCause(); if (cause != null) { method = resolveMethodByExceptionType(cause.getClass()); } } return method; }
private static <X extends Exception> X newWithCause(Class<X> exceptionClass, Throwable cause) { // getConstructors() guarantees this as long as we don't modify the array. @SuppressWarnings({"unchecked", "rawtypes"}) List<Constructor<X>> constructors = (List) Arrays.asList(exceptionClass.getConstructors()); for (Constructor<X> constructor : preferringStrings(constructors)) { @Nullable X instance = newFromConstructor(constructor, cause); if (instance != null) { if (instance.getCause() == null) { instance.initCause(cause); } return instance; } } throw new IllegalArgumentException( "No appropriate constructor for exception of type " + exceptionClass + " in response to chained exception", cause); }
